That's fantastic!  Don't forget that if you can get your hair french braided, you can tuck the ends back up and under the braid.  This gives a very nice, professional, sophisticated look that is easy to do and it makes it look like your hair is longer than it really is.

Congratulations, RTG!  Its exciting!!  I suggest working on a Dutch braid (insideout French braid)-when my hair was on the short side, it would hold much better and longer for me than a French braid.
